Faithful, Firm, and True: African-American Education in the South provides a thorough analysis of the important contributions made by early champions of black education in central Georgia and the central role played by Ballard Normal School. It is essential reading for scholars of African-American history, education, and Georgia history.

This is not right. A partnership is based in mutual trust and this was established by case law. The partners owe each other a duty of good faith. In Const v Harris Lord Eldon said that “In all partnerships, whether it is expressed in the deed or not, the partners are bound to be true and faithful to each other”.
